Saudi Smart Logistics Exhibition Showcases Latest Global Technology Solutions

Participants and experts at the Saudi Smart Logistics Exhibition 2026 said Saudi Arabia has become a global destination for showcasing the latest innovations and technology solutions in logistics and supply chains, amid the accelerating industrial transformation supporting Saudi Vision 2030 objectives.

The fourth edition of the exhibition is being held from June 21 to 24 as part of Riyadh International Industry Week 2026, which brings together leading decision-makers, government officials, investors, experts, and local and international industrial and engineering companies.

The exhibition showcases the latest technology solutions and advanced practices in logistics, material handling, warehousing, and supply chains, along with automation, robotics, and artificial intelligence technologies, helping enhance the sector’s efficiency and support the shift toward smart industry.

It also serves as a platform for knowledge exchange and showcasing the latest products, services, and technologies that drive the development of the industrial and logistics sectors, while creating opportunities for partnerships and investment between local and international entities.

Chinese exhibitor Andrew Chai, representing a company specializing in sensing and measurement technologies, said his company presented a range of advanced solutions in weight sensors and industrial sensing technologies at the exhibition.

“We are a Chinese company specializing in manufacturing force and weight sensors. During our participation, we are showcasing weight sensors, integrated weighing modules, in addition to controllers and signal amplifiers used in various industrial applications,” Chai said.



He added that participating in the exhibition enabled the company to introduce its products to companies operating in the Saudi market and build relationships with entities interested in industrial and logistics technologies. He noted that the Kingdom represents a promising market for smart solutions and modern automation technologies.

Exhibitor categories at the exhibition include warehouse and equipment management systems, industrial racking and storage systems, robotics and automation, last-mile and fulfillment logistics solutions, storage and facility technologies, software and industrial equipment, cold-chain technologies and services, packaging, weighing and measurement solutions, information and communication technologies, freight services, and advanced technology systems.

Riyadh International Industry Week 2026 brings together three specialized exhibitions held concurrently: Saudi Plastics & Petrochem and Saudi Print & Pack, both in their 21st editions, and the 4th edition of Saudi Smart Logistics.

The event is underpinned by a strategic partnership between Riyadh Exhibitions Company Ltd. and Germany’s Messe Düsseldorf, aimed at linking the specialized Saudi exhibitions with leading global trade fairs, including K for plastics and rubber; Interpack for processing and packaging; and Drupa for printing technologies. The partnership helps strengthen the Kingdom’s position as a regional and global hub for industry, logistics, and advanced technologies.
